The Role of Culture in Teaching English in Peru

Teaching English in Peru can be an unforgettable experience for anyone passionate about education and discovering new cultures. As a teacher, you will not only have the opportunity to help people improve their lives through language, but you will also gain a unique perspective on life and education in a developing country. In this blog post, we will explore the benefits of teaching English in Peru and some of the challenges you might face as a teacher. So let’s dive in and discover how Teach in Peru can be a truly unique educational journey.

The Benefits of Teaching English in Peru

Teaching English in Peru can be an incredibly fulfilling experience as you help people improve their communication and employment opportunities. You will be able to witness the impact of your work firsthand and be inspired by the progress your students make. You will also have the opportunity to learn from your students and colleagues as they share their culture and experiences with you. As a teacher, you will have the chance to explore new teaching techniques and adapt your approach to suit the needs of your students.

The Challenges You Might Face

Teaching English in Peru can be challenging, especially if you are unfamiliar with the language and culture. You will need to be patient, flexible, and adaptable to succeed in this environment. You may also need to develop creative lesson plans that engage your students and promote active learning. Additionally, you will need to adjust to the long working hours and limited resources available in many schools. However, with the right attitude and approach, you can overcome these challenges and thrive as a teacher in Peru.

The Best Places to Teach English in Peru

Peru is a diverse country with many regions and cities that offer exciting teaching opportunities. Lima, the capital city, is the most popular destination for English teachers due to its large population and high demand for language education. Other popular locations include Cusco, Arequipa, and Trujillo, which offer a more relaxed and authentic experience of Peruvian culture. Whether you prefer the hustle and bustle of city life or the tranquility of the countryside, there is a teaching opportunity for you in Peru.

The Requirements for Teaching English in Peru

To teach English in Peru, you will need to have a bachelor’s degree and a teaching certification, such as TESOL or TEFL. You will also need to have at least six months of teaching experience and be fluent in English. Some schools may require additional qualifications or language skills depending on their needs. It’s also important to obtain a work visa before teaching in Peru, which can be a lengthy and complex process. However, many schools offer assistance with visa applications and can guide you through the necessary steps.

How to Find Teaching Opportunities in Peru

There are several ways to find teaching opportunities in Peru, including online job boards, recruitment agencies, and personal connections. Many schools and language centers will also advertise job openings on their websites or social media pages. However, it’s important to research potential employers and ensure they have a good reputation and fair employment practices. It’s also helpful to network with other teachers and attend local events to learn about the teaching community in Peru.


Teaching English in Peru can be a truly unique and rewarding educational journey that offers personal and professional growth. While there are challenges and requirements involved, with the right attitude and approach, you can succeed as a teacher in Peru. Whether you are looking for an adventurous and cultural experience or an opportunity to make a positive impact through education, teaching English in Peru is a great choice. So take the leap and embark on a teaching adventure in Peru today!


Juno Ivy Richards: Juno, an environmental health advocate, discusses the impact of environmental factors on health, climate change, and sustainable living practices.